Output 3ba8dec16a42875c7de8c31fa57b807f03154ac1dff89a78b754f4e64b6012be:19

value
1033901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beff4bde2809c8943a4d1dd669e59bdf19566d13 OP_EQUAL
address
3K6v9HybL1FzkU4ezMNvBCdxBHbDgcjcVu
transaction
3ba8dec16a42875c7de8c31fa57b807f03154ac1dff89a78b754f4e64b6012be
spent
true